The purpose of this program was to offer to members of the law enforcement <br />community HUD-owned houses in specific target areas at half price with the intent to prevent crime and <br />promote neighborhood safety and security in economically distressed neighborhoods. <br /> <br />The Program is largely one between the individual officer and HUD. HUD offers eligible properties on the <br />Internet each Tuesday evening. Officers have until the following Sunday evening to respond to HUD with <br />an expression of interest is specific homes. The officer is then given a "lottery" number and each week HUD <br />has a drawing to select the officer who will be given the chance to purchase each specific property. <br /> <br />The local contact for this program to obtain information is Bruce Kulpa of the Riverside Housing <br />Development Corporation. Mr. Kulpa reports that the program has been operating locally since February <br />1998 and has proven to be very successful. Prior to HUD posting the properties on the Internet, the <br />Riverside Housing Development Corporation was the site to pick up the weekly eligible property listing. <br />Mr. Kulpa reports that he would have a line of officers outside his office on Wednesday mornings to pick <br />up the list. Because the final dealings are between HUD and the officer Mr. Kulpa has no idea as to the <br />number of officers who have bought in Riverside, but he feels there have been quite a few. <br /> <br />To give this program a further boost, the City will prepare an announcement to be provided to Riverside <br />Police Officers explaining the program. <br /> <br />RECOMMENDATION: <br /> <br />That the City Council receive and file this report. <br /> <br />Prepared <br /> <br />Lawrence E.
